Assam D.El.Ed Admission 2026: The official notification for admission into the 2-Year Diploma in Elementary Education (D.El.Ed.) Course for the session 2026 – 2028 has been released by the State Council of Educational Research and Training (SCERT), Assam. Interested and eligible candidates are required to apply online for the Pre-Entry Test (PET) – 2026 in order to be considered for admission to this course.
Primary & Secondary Schooling (K-12)
The course will be held in NCTE recognized Teacher Education Institutes (DIET/ CTE/ Normal School/ BTC/ Pvt. TEIs) in the state for the academic years 2026 – 2028.

Eligibility Criteria:-
Age Limit:
The Candidates Should Not be less Than 18 Years of Age and Not more than 34 Years. As on 1st July 2026.
- For ST Candidates: 02 Years+
- For SC Candidates: 02 Years+
Used Age Calculator: Click Here
Educational Qualification:
The candidate must have achieved a minimum of 50% marks in aggregate in their Higher Secondary (+2) or equivalent examination from recognized Boards/Councils, excluding marks obtained in extra/optional/fourth subjects.
Candidates from SC/ST/ST(H) category will receive a 5% relaxation in aggregate marks.

Payment Mode: Candidates can pay their examination fees through an online payment gateway. Candidates should have any one of the following options to make the online payment – Debit Card, Credit Card, Net Banking or UPI.
Residency Requirement: Only candidates who are permanent residents of Assam are eligible to apply for this course.
Seat Reservation: Seats will be reserved for candidates from reserved categories such as OBC/MOBC/SC/ST(P)/ST(H)/Person With Disability (PWD) according to government guidelines.
Admit Card Information: Candidates can download their SCERT Assam D.El.Ed PET Admit Card from the website https://scertpet.co.in starting from 5th July 2026 by entering their Application Number and Date of Birth used during online application submission.
PET Venue: The Pre-Entry Test (PET) 2026 will take place in the district selected by candidates during online application submission, as indicated on their ADMIT card. Selected candidates will be allocated seats in Teacher Education Institutes (TEIs) in the chosen district for the PET-2026.

D.El.Ed Syllabus Pre-Entry Test (PET)
Candidates aspiring to take up teaching as a profession at elementary level may apply to appear in the Pre-Entry Test (PET) – 2026 for admission into 2-year Diploma in Elementary Education (D.El.Ed.) course. Here we will provide the question pattern, syllabus and all other details about PET 2026.
Primary & Secondary Schooling (K-12)
The Test shall have two Sections: Section-I and Section-II. Other details are as mentioned below.
Total Marks: 100 Marks
Time: 2 hours
Type of questions: MCQ
Number of question: 100 questions
Mark carried by each question: 1
Negative marking: For every incorrect response, 0.25 mark shall be deducted.
Section-I
| Subject | Marks |
|---|---|
| General English | 10 Marks |
| General Knowledge | 15 Marks |
| Reasoning | 10 Marks |
| Total | 35 Marks |
General English: Vocabulary, tenses, verbs, preposition, comprehension, voice-change, narration, adverbs, synonyms, antonyms.
General Knowledge: Current affairs, who is who, abbreviations, constitution of India, History of Assam, Inventions and discoveries, Sports. Art and culture, Every day Science, World Organizations, Geography of India, Educational Commissions and Committees, New Educational Initiatives, Educational Organizations.
